Ancient Origins of King Solomon’s Legendary Ring

While the biblical King Solomon is renowned for his wisdom and wealth, the legend of his magical ring emerges from sources outside the canonical scriptures.
You’ll find the earliest references in non-canonical texts like the Account of Solomon, dating from the 1st to 4th centuries CE.
These ancient writings describe a divine signet ring engraved with sacred symbols—often a pentagram—representing supernatural authority granted through angelic messengers.
According to the Testament of Solomon, the ring gave Solomon power to command all demons, both male and female, compelling them to labor on the construction of the Temple.

Commanding Spirits and Demons
According to medieval mystical traditions, Solomon’s legendary ring served as the ultimate instrument for commanding demons and spirits. The ring contained God’s divine name, granting absolute authority over supernatural entities.
You’ll find that demons were compelled to reveal their names and weaknesses when confronted with the ring’s seal. Solomon used this power to bind demons, forcing them to build his Temple and submit to his will without resistance.

Cultural Journey Across Jewish, Islamic, and Kabbalistic Traditions

The Ring of Solomon’s mystical legacy traces a fascinating path through three interconnected traditions, each layering new meanings onto this ancient symbol of divine authority.
You’ll find its earliest roots in Jewish Talmudic tales, where Solomon commanded demons through divine names.
Medieval Islamic scholars expanded these concepts, emphasizing control over jinn and spiritual expertise.
Kabbalah then absorbed these influences, altering the ring into a meditation tool connecting earthly and celestial domains.
